Excluir vários registros do TClientDataSet
19/05/2003
0
Prezados,
Tenho dois TClientDatSet, um tem os registros mestre (Assuntos), e o outro tem os registros detalhe (Sinônimos). Quando estou alterando o registro mestre, dou a possibilidade do usuário excluir os registros detalhe (um ou mais).
Porém, quando vou dar um ApplyUpdates em ambos os ClientDataSet, dá o seguinte erro: ´Atualização afeta mais de um registro.´
[cod]
cds_Assunto.applyUpdates(0);
cds_Sinonimo.applyUpdates(0);
[/code]
Alguém sabe como solucionar isto?
Agradeço desde já
:lol:
Tenho dois TClientDatSet, um tem os registros mestre (Assuntos), e o outro tem os registros detalhe (Sinônimos). Quando estou alterando o registro mestre, dou a possibilidade do usuário excluir os registros detalhe (um ou mais).
cds_Sinonimo.Delete;
Porém, quando vou dar um ApplyUpdates em ambos os ClientDataSet, dá o seguinte erro: ´Atualização afeta mais de um registro.´
[cod]
cds_Assunto.applyUpdates(0);
cds_Sinonimo.applyUpdates(0);
[/code]
Alguém sabe como solucionar isto?
Agradeço desde já
:lol:
Nglauber
Curtir tópico
+ 0
Responder
Clique aqui para fazer login e interagir na Comunidade :)